gpt4 book ai didi

java - 如何检查 LiveData 或 MutableLiveData 是否已设置值?

转载 作者:行者123 更新时间:2023-12-01 17:55:16 26 4
gpt4 key购买 nike

如何检查某个值是否已设置为 LiveData?我想这样做是因为如果我还没有设置一个值,我将设置一个起始值,然后从这个起始值我将得到下一个值。

myMutable.getValue() !== null 

我想做这样的事情。

最佳答案

您正在创建 LiveData 吗?

如果是这样,您可以在创建时将初始值传递给构造函数。

示例:

LiveData<Integer> liveData = new LiveData<>(1);
//liveData.getValue() == 1

如果没有,您可以检查 LiveData 是否具有与您指定的值相同但使用 != 运算符设置的值。!== 不是有效的 java 运算符。

关于java - 如何检查 LiveData 或 MutableLiveData 是否已设置值?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/60728818/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com